The Audi Q5, often referred to simply as the Audi Q5, is a compact luxury SUV renowned for its blend of performance, comfort, and advanced technology. Manufactured by the German automaker Audi, a subsidiary of Volkswagen Group, the Q5 has been a popular choice since its initial release in 2008, with various updates enhancing its appeal. Known for its refined handling and sophisticated design, the Q5 features a range of efficient engines and innovative safety features, making it a versatile option for modern drivers. Its build quality and reputation for reliability reflect Audi’s commitment to engineering excellence, positioning the Q5 as a standout in the competitive luxury SUV segment.

Understanding MOT Defect Categories

Dangerous Direct and immediate risk to road safety or the environment. Vehicle must not be driven until repaired.
Major May affect safety, environment, or other road users. Repair immediately.
Minor No significant effect on safety but should be repaired as soon as possible.
Advisory Could become more serious in the future. Monitor and repair if necessary.
